Ada, Mich. (August 25, 2026)—Baker Publishing Group is celebrating seven wins at the 2026 Golden Scroll Awards, which took place on Sunday, August 2. Hosted for the eighteenth year by the Advanced Writers and Speakers Association (AWSA), the awards recognize excellence in writing, speaking, and ministry impact among its members, now numbering over 1,100.

 

New York Times bestselling Revell author Lynette Eason received three of the awards. She won the Christian Market Suspense Novel of the Year for Serial Burn, as well as second place for the Mystery/Suspense Novel of the Year for Final Approach, and third place in the same category for Serial Burn. She also received an honorable mention for Novella of the Year for Snowbound Secrets, which appears in the Whiteout collection.

AWSA recognized four other Baker Publishing Group authors. Tracie Peterson and Kimberley Woodhouse, publishing with Bethany House, won second place for Western Novel of the Year and third place for Christian Market Novel of the Year for An Unexpected Grace; Woodhouse also took second place for Historical Novel of the Year with A Song in the Dark (Bethany House). Karen Witemeyer’s novella A Star in the West, featured in On a Midnight Clear (Bethany House), won third place for Novella of the Year. And bestselling author Dani Pettrey earned an honorable mention for Mystery/Suspense Novel of the Year for Two Seconds Too Late (Bethany House).
